Abstract
The last known location of a beacon associated with an asset can be determined based on the beacon'"'"'s last communication with a data network. A beacon can be set up to communicate its location to or through a server to a second client used for locating and tracking the beacon after the beacon obtains a wireless data network connection and registers its most recent location with the server. Beacon location can be based on data network router IP address or GPS information. Location can be stored in memory until a subsequent location and/or wireless connection is obtained. A beacon can also include short range wireless communications to facilitate short range radio frequency communications with a second client that are determined to be in close proximity to the beacon. Short-range communications can be facilitated utilizing Bluetooth communications.
